摘要
Lanthanide (Ln) extractions from organic acids to n-dodecane by N,N,N', N'-tetraoctyl-diglycolamide (TODGA) were conducted. Four organic acids (lactic acid, malonic acid, tartaric acid, and citric acid) were employed. Although these acids stabilize lanthanides in the aqueous phase, a distribution ratio (D) greater 1 was obtained for heavy Ln. Ln patterns (D(Ln) against atomic number of Ln) show maximum values of Ho and Er. In order to obtain high D values, the addition of HNO3 in aqueous phase was found to be effective.
